Florida Atlantic Owls Fall Short Against UCF Knights in Orlando Showdown
The Florida Atlantic Owls faced off against the UCF Knights at the State Farm Field House in Orlando, resulting in a narrow defeat for the Owls with a final score of 85-80. This game leaves the Owls with a record of 0-1, while the Knights improve to 1-0.
First Half
The first half saw both teams battling fiercely on the court. The Florida Atlantic Owls managed to establish an early lead, thanks to their impressive shooting accuracy. Isaiah Elohim stood out with his dynamic playmaking, contributing significantly to FAU's offensive efforts. The team shot 44 percent from the field and maintained a strong presence inside, scoring 40 points in the paint.
Despite their efforts, FAU struggled with turnovers, committing 12 throughout the game. However, they managed to capitalize on second-chance opportunities by securing offensive rebounds and converting them into points.
Second Half
As play resumed after halftime, UCF began mounting pressure on FAU's defense. The Knights' fast break points became a crucial factor as they scored an impressive total of 23 fast break points during this period. Their ability to convert turnovers into quick scores allowed them to close any gaps created by FAU's earlier lead.
Max Langenfeld and Devin Williams made notable contributions for FAU during this half but were unable to counteract UCF’s momentum fully.
